Bactrian Deer vs Buff-shouldered Widowbird
Cervus hanglu compared with Euplectes psammacromius
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bactrian Deer | Buff-shouldered Widowbird |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) | Passeriformes (Songbirds) |
| Family | Cervidae (Deer) | Ploceidae |
| Genus | Cervus (True Deer) | Euplectes |
| Species | Cervus hanglu | Euplectes psammacromius |
Evolutionary Relationship
Bactrian Deer and Buff-shouldered Widowbird share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
